Billy is a career banker with over 30 years of experience in the financial services industry. His areas of expertise include Project Management, Information Technology, Banking Operations, Electronic Banking, Card Services, and E-Government. Previous senior management responsibilities included oversight of teams of varying Banking and Technology professionals focusing on delivery of products, services, and electronic delivery channels. In one of his previous roles Billy also maintained Group oversight of project management and IT professionals spread across multiple jurisdictions including Cayman, Bermuda, London and Guernsey. More recently he was appointed as Strategic Advisor to the Cabinet Office to assist the E-Government unit with their Electronic ID implementation. Billy is a past member of junior achievement and the CI Immigration Appeals Tribunal. He joined Cayman National in 2021 and is currently Executive Vice President, Group Chief Information Officer & Digital Channels.

Brian is the Executive Vice President of Cayman National Corporation and has been with the bank since 2008. He has is an accomplished career banker having international banking experience with a Canadian bank in Vancouver and Kamloops, British Columbia prior to arriving at Cayman National. He is also the Past President for the Cayman Islands Bankers Association (CIBA) and a current serving Board Member of the association.

Bryan A. Hunter

Bryan was the previous Managing Partner and the Head of the Corporate and Commercial Practice in the Cayman office of the law firm Appleby. He has extensive experience in the structuring and formation of hedge funds, funds of funds and private equity funds and regularly advises on various operational and regulatory issues in relation to these funds. His expertise also includes general corporate matters, project finance, corporate finance and merger and acquisition transactions. He was admitted as an attorney in the Cayman Islands in 1997. He is a notary public in the Cayman Islands, has served as a board member of the Civil Aviation Authority, the Caymanian Bar Association (of which he is a past President) and the Chamber of Commerce and has served as a member of the Financial Services Council.

Whan Tong is EVP/Group Legal Counsel and Corporate Secretary for Cayman National Corporation Ltd., and is responsible for, oversees, or advises on legal and corporate secretarial affairs of CNC and its subsidiaries, data governance and privacy, and real property. Ian was first called to the bar in 1996, and practised commercial and regulatory litigation in Toronto at Fasken Martineau. He practiced corporate law in the Cayman Islands from 2002, and was Chief Policy Officer at the Cayman Islands Monetary Authority in 2004. He joined Cayman National as its first and only counsel in 2007. Ian obtained his AB from Princeton University, and his MPA and JD from Dalhousie University. He was awarded the CAMS designation, and holds both CIPP/E and CIPM certifications in privacy and data protection. He expects to earn the GPC.D certification in governance in 2024. He was a top 8 finalist among 3000+ nominees for the Global Counsel Awards. As a volunteer, he founded and is the tournament director of the only high school debating competition in the Cayman Islands.

Janet's career comprises decades of senior level banking experience, having held senior positions with CIBC, Barclays Bank, and Deutsche Bank (Cayman) Limited, serving at the latter for 11 years as Chief Country Officer prior to her appointment as President of Cayman National Bank Ltd. in April 2019, and then as Chief Executive Officer of Cayman National Corporation in January 2023. In her earlier years, Ms Hislop was employed by the Cayman Islands Government as a Genetics Counselor/Medical Social Worker and later as a Training Manager. Ms. Hislop holds a BSc Hons in Financial Services from the University of Manchester, United Kingdom; and a BSc Hons in Molecular Biology and Genetics from the University of Guelph, Canada. She also has several professional qualifications; among these are TEP, CAMS, and ACIB, and she also successfully completed The Canadian Securities Course.

Ryan is a career banker with 20 years of banking and regulatory experience. His career started with Republic Bank Limited, Trinidad & Tobago, and over the years he has served various financial institutions at senior levels. Among his appointments have been Director, Risk, CIBC with responsibility for governance, market, credit, liquidity and operational risk; Compliance Manager, Royal Bank of Canada, overseeing trust, captive insurance, mutual fund, private banking and security brokerage business lines; and Deputy Head of Banking Supervision, Cayman Islands Monetary Authority with direct responsibility for the Basel II implementation in the Cayman Islands. He has also consulted for financial services companies throughout the Caribbean on AML/CFT and risk management. Ryan is currently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er for Cayman National Corporation Ltd. with responsibility for operations, information technology, risk and compliance of the group's subsidiary banks, trust companies, fund administrator and securities brokerage. He holds a B.Sc. (Hons.) in Management and Finance from the University of the West Indies, is a Certified Anti-Money Laundering Specialist and holds the Financial Risk Manager designation from the Global Association of Risk Professionals.

Sherri Bodden-Cowan

Sherri was educated in the Cayman Islands and the United Kingdom, and gained an LLB (Hons) from Bristol University, England. She was subsequently called to the Bar of England & Wales in 1986 and the Cayman Islands in 1987. She has worked for the Cayman Islands Government, the law firm Hunter & Hunter, and was an associate and partner of Boxalls law firm. She is the previous owner of the law firm, Bodden & Bodden, and formerly served as a director of Bodden Corporate Services. She was awarded an M.B.E. by Her Majesty the Queen for services to the community and in particular to immigration in June 2004 and she has served in numerous capacities as chairman or director of various Cayman Islands statutory boards and authorities.
